WebUninstall from Control Panel. In search on the taskbar, enter Control Panel and select it from the results. Select Programs > Programs and Features. Press and hold (or right-click) on the program you want to remove and select Uninstall or Uninstall / Change. Then follow the directions on the screen.

Run Finder App. Choose “Utilities” from the “Go” drop-down menu on the top. In the … WebAug 19, 2024 · Just follow these instructions: Step 1: Open Control Panel on your Windows PC. Step 2: Navigate to Programs > Programs and Features. Step 3: Find and choose iTunes and then click the Uninstall option to uninstall it. Step 4: Now uninstall all the components that are related to iTunes.
